当前位置:首页 » 编程语言 » sqlpython
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sqlpython

发布时间: 2022-02-17 13:31:44

sql和python哪个难学

综述:python。

实际上两者的难度是相似的。 相对而言SQL可能相对容易一些。 毕竟,SQL不需要很多命令,并且更容易编写。要学习结构化查询语言,您必须首先学习数据库的基础知识,然后再学习SQL动词的用法。

简介:

Python由荷兰数学和计算机科学研究学会的Guido van Rossum于1990 年代初设计,作为一门叫做ABC语言的替代品。

Python提供了高效的高级数据结构,还能简单有效地面向对象编程。Python语法和动态类型,以及解释型语言的本质,使它成为多数平台上写脚本和快速开发应用的编程语言,随着版本的不断更新和语言新功能的添加,逐渐被用于独立的、大型项目的开发。

② sql和python有什么区别

一、性质不同

1、sql:是一种特殊目的的编程语言,是一种数据库查询和程序设计语言。

2、python:Python由荷兰数学和计算机科学研究学会的Guido van Rossum于1990 年代初设计,作为一门叫做ABC语言的替代品。

二、作用不同

1、sql:用于存取数据以及查询、更新和管理关系数据库系统。

2、python:Python提供了高效的高级数据结构,还能简单有效地面向对象编程。

三、特点不同

1、sql:不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式,所以具有完全不同底层结构的不同数据库系统, 可以使用相同的结构化查询语言作为数据输入与管理的接口。

2、python:Python语法和动态类型,以及解释型语言的本质,使它成为多数平台上写脚本和快速开发应用的编程语言,随着版本的不断更新和语言新功能的添加,逐渐被用于独立的、大型项目的开发。

③ python和sql比起来,哪个简单

Python是一种解释型、面向对象、动态数据类型的高级程序设计语言。

sql 结构化查询语言

sql相对容易

④ python如何操作SQL语句

这里有个比较清楚的解答:
http://..com/question/262503775.html

但是你的是一个文本的话,就要稍微改一下咯

如果改成cx_Oracle的话,就是这样的:

import sys
import cx_Oracle
import os

class handleDataBase:
def __init__(self,user,passwd,server,sql):
self.user=user
self.passwd=passwd
self.server=server
self.sql=sql
self.conn = cx_Oracle.connect("%s/%s@%s"%(self.user,self.passwd,self.server))

def selectDB(self):
cursor = self.conn.cursor()
cursor.execute("select count(1) from search_item_08")
ret = cursor.fetchall()
cursor.close()
print ret
return ret

def closeDB(self):
self.conn.close()

if __name__ == "__main__":
if len(sys.argv) < 4:
print "Need Arguments: user passwd server"
sys.exit(1)

user=sys.argv[1]
passwd=sys.argv[2]
server=sys.argv[3]
#sql='select count(1) from search_item_08;' #注意这里要改
sql = open('a.sql','r').read() #改成从文件读取

#接下来就访问数据库了
handleDB = handleDataBase(user,passwd,server,sql)
handleDB.selectDB()
handleDB.closeDB()

⑤ 对于数据分析sql和python有什么区别

sql能进行复杂的回归分析吗?它只能统计筛选这些基操,python能存数据吗?不能,却能进行几乎你能想到的所有计算

⑥ sql和python哪个难学

sql和python都不难学,只要愿意用心学习都会有成绩。sql是关系型数据库信息系统,想要深入掌握,需要学习数据结构方面的基础知识。python属于面向数据应用程序开发语言,sql基础好,更容易掌握python。

⑦ Python和SQL有没有什么共同点

python是编程语言
SQL是数据库结构化查询语言
不是一类东西
python web有相关的数据库包

⑧ python.sql在哪里

没有SQL,可以用自带的e32dbm或者自己用OPEN函数写个数据库模块

⑨ sql和python先学习哪个

一个是数据库,一个是编程语言。软件离不开数据,也离不开处理数据的工具。两者是相辅相成的,先学习哪个不重要,因为你肯定两个都要会,也就是说你都要学,先学哪个就不重要了。

⑩ SQL和Python 哪个更容易自学

SQL更容易自学。

结构化查询语言简称SQL。结构化查询语言是高级的非过程化编程语言,允许用户在高层数据结构上工作。它不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式。

所以具有完全不同底层结构的不同数据库系统, 可以使用相同的结构化查询语言作为数据输入与管理的接口。结构化查询语言语句可以嵌套,这使它具有极大的灵活性和强大的功能。

功能:

1、SQL数据定义功能:能够定义数据库的三级模式结构,即外模式、全局模式和内模式结构。在SQL中,外模式又叫做视图,全局模式简称模式,内模式由系统根据数据库模式自动实现,一般无需用户过问。

2、SQL数据操纵功能:包括对基本表和视图的数据插入、删除和修改,特别是具有很强的数据查询功能。

3、SQL的数据控制功能:主要是对用户的访问权限加以控制,以保证系统的安全性。

以上内容参考网络—sql